"RealityServer® lets you take
advantage of photorealistic 3d graphics in collaborative,
server-based web applications. use RealityServer to
deploy 3d content and applications within web-centric
solutions in all industries that utilize 3d data created
with Computer Aided Design and Digital Content Creation
software.
RealityServer® enables the interactive
manipulation, visualization and annotation of existing
and newly-created 3d content within enterprise software
solutions. it is based on novel, patented, server-centric
technologies for web deployment in any field in which
large amounts of complex 3d data are utilized, such as
architectural and mechanical design.
Key Benefits
the
RealityServer® platform uniquely provides essential
features that are required for building 3d applications
and web services, including:
• fully interactive and
collaborative interaction with 3d design content is
guaranteed independently of the front-end device
capabilities.
• many
users can simultaneously work or play collaboratively and
remotely.
• proprietary content and data is
protected and efficiently managed in one central secure
environment.
• each solution is scalable
with regard to data complexity, performance, image
quality and number of simultaneous
users.
•
RealityServer® comes with a software developer kit
(SDK) and the RealityDesigner™ toolkit for the
development of applications and their integration into
corporate environments.
• developers can enhance and
extend the system at every level through a comprehensive
extensible environment.
well documented programming interfaces and reusable
source code examples for key system components are all
based on industry
standard languages and protocols.
RealityServer®
supports and scales
across multiple commodity hardware platforms and
operating systems."
